Lot Essay
The design for Stromberg's amphibious power base, Atlantis was conceived by Ken Adam. The overall effect of Adam's futuristic vision was stunning. In Adam's words ...My Bond designs and all my other ahead-of-modern designs were always very linear; simple but efficient, with a bareness of line. But on Spy I also went into curved shapes. The combination excited me...something just clicked and I knew I'd done it right...
This scale model was built by special effects wizard, Derek Meddings, to Ken Adam's designs.
The film's chief villain, Karl Stromberg [Curt Jurgens], a billionaire shipping magnate, lives on Atlantis, his unique amphibious power base, capable of supporting life above or below the surface. As Pfeiffer and Worrall's synopsis of Bond's assignment explains: Stromberg is obsessed with bringing civilization to the depths of the ocean..for megalomaniacal purposes: he dreams of establishing himself as dictator of the new world order. In the film's climax, Bond [Roger Moore] working with top Soviet spy Major Anya Amasova [Barbara Bach] take part .. in a fierce battle with Stromberg's forces and the freed crews from nuclear submarines the villain had captured, and narrrowly avert a nuclear holocaust. Bond kills Stromberg and escapes the exploding Atlantis with Anya.
The model in this lot is thought to be the one that Stromberg shows Bond, [Roger Moore] disguised as marine biologist Richard Stirling, when he visits Stromberg in his world beneath the sea. As they are looking at a scale model of Atlantis, Stromberg tells Bond/Stirling of his vision ...An underwater city...the only hope for the future of mankind....
